Why This Market Is Growing So Fast
It starts with the patient population. Cardiovascular disease is not slowing down — if anything, it is accelerating. Sedentary lifestyles, poor dietary habits, and an increasingly older global population have created a vast and growing pool of individuals living with damaged or deteriorating heart valves. For many of these patients, tissue valves are simply the better option.
The appeal is practical. Unlike mechanical valves, bioprosthetic options do not chain patients to lifelong anticoagulation medications. For someone in their late sixties or seventies, avoiding that daily pharmaceutical burden can meaningfully improve quality of life. Add to that the rise of minimally invasive procedures — particularly transcatheter aortic valve replacement — and you have a market that is meeting patients where they are, not where the old surgical playbook left them. North America currently dominates market share, though emerging economies across Asia-Pacific and Latin America are steadily narrowing that gap.
The Science Behind the Device
At its core, the Tissue Heart Valves Mechanism is a careful imitation of nature. Leaflets harvested from bovine pericardium or porcine tissue are treated and mounted onto a structural frame, engineered to replicate the precise open-and-close rhythm of a healthy human valve. When the heart contracts, the valve opens; when it relaxes, the valve shuts. Blood flows where it should and stays where it should.
The chemical treatment process — most commonly using glutaraldehyde — strips the tissue of properties that might trigger immune rejection while preserving its mechanical function. The honest trade-off is longevity. Most tissue valves perform reliably for 10 to 20 years before structural wear begins to set in. But that limitation is fast becoming less of a ceiling and more of a challenge that researchers are determined to break through. Anti-calcification coatings and synthetic polymer leaflets are already changing what is possible, and the pace of progress suggests the durability gap will continue to close.
Who Is Shaping the Industry
The competitive landscape within Tissue Heart Valves Companies is defined by both scale and ambition. Edwards Lifesciences has long held a commanding position, with its SAPIEN valve platform recognized globally as a gold standard in transcatheter technology. Medtronic brings its own weight to the table through the CoreValve and Evolut product lines. Abbott, Boston Scientific, LivaNova, and JenaValve Technology round out a competitive field that is anything but static.
What is particularly notable is how these companies are expanding the eligible patient base. Procedures once reserved for elderly or high-risk individuals are now being explored for younger, lower-risk patients — a shift that could dramatically expand the market's total addressable population in the years ahead.
